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the battery to ensure safety during the repair process.
  • Raise the vehicle if necessary and secure it with jack stands.
2. Replace Spark Plugs
  • Remove Engine Cover: If applicable, remove the engine cover by unscrewing fasteners.
  • Remove Ignition Coils: Disconnect the electrical connectors and remove the bolts holding the ignition coils in place. Carefully pull them out.
  • Remove Spark Plugs: Use a spark plug socket to unscrew and remove the old spark plugs. Inspect the plugs for signs of wear or damage.
  • Install New Spark Plugs: Apply anti-seize lubricant to the threads of the new spark plugs, then install them by hand to avoid cross-threading. Tighten to manufacturer specifications (typically around 13-15 ft-lbs).
  • Reinstall Ignition Coils: Place the ignition coils back and secure them with bolts. Reconnect the electrical connectors.
3. Check and Replace Ignition Coils (if necessary)
  • If misfire codes indicate faulty ignition coils, replace them by following similar steps to the spark plug replacement.
  • Ensure that new coils are compatible with the engine model.
4. Inspect and Clean Fuel Injectors
  • Access Fuel Injectors: Depending on the configuration, you may need to remove the fuel rail.
  • Clean or Replace Injectors: Use a fuel injector cleaning kit or replace with new injectors if they are clogged or malfunctioning.
5. Verify Compression
  • If compression tests show low pressure in any cylinder, further inspection is needed. This may involve checking the head gasket or valves.
